Buying Guide: How to Choose Driveway Edging and Grids
Key considerations when selecting edging or geocell grids for gravel driveways include load requirements, installation method, climate, and未来 long-term maintenance. Here are practical guidance points from multiple perspectives:
- Load requirements: For driveways that regularly bear cars or light trucks, prioritize edging systems with high load-bearing capacity and stable edge containment. Geocell grids also help distribute loads and reduce rutting where gravel is loose.
- Installation method: Hammer-in metal edging and interlocking boards offer quick, tool-light setup for straight lines or gentle curves. Flexible corrugated edging is best for curved layouts, while geocell grids require stakes and fill materials to lock in place.
- Durability and weather: Galvanized steel edges resist rust and weathering, suitable for exposed locations. HDPE geocell grids provide corrosion resistance and are lightweight, though extreme conditions may demand stronger edge borders.
- Maintenance: Edging should minimize gravel migration and require minimal adjustment over time. Grids reduce erosion on slopes but may need periodic topping with gravel for evenness.
- Terrain adaptation: Sloped or uneven ground benefits from geocell grids that stabilize soils. Straight, long driveways benefit from rigid or flexible edging that preserves a crisp boundary.
- Storage and handling: Foldable or modular grids simplify transport and on-site fitting. Consider the space required for storage when purchasing multiple panels or grids.

Integrated Tips for Installing Driveway Edging with Gravel
Before placing edging, define a clear boundary with string lines to ensure straight runs or smooth curves. For metal edging, use a rubber mallet or hammer to insert stakes evenly along the border. When using geocell grids, anchor perimeters with stakes, then fill cells gradually with gravel to achieve uniform height. For slopes, begin at the lowest point and work upward to minimize fill slippage. Regularly check the edging alignment after heavy weather or traffic to keep the gravel contained and the drive looking tidy.
